Summary

  • Reverse-level
  • Four ground-floor bedrooms: 1 x king-size with en-suite walk-in shower, basin, heated towel rail and WC with adjoining dressing room with 2ft6in day bed suitable for child and space for a cot, 1 x king-size with en-suite bath, shower over, basin and WC, 2 x twin
  • Ground-floor bathroom with corner bath, basin and WC
  • First-floor open-plan living space with kitchen, dining area and sitting area with woodburning stove
  • Electric heating available
  • Oil-fired AGA, gas hob, electric oven, microwave, fridge/freezer, washing machine, tumble dryer, dishwasher
  • TV with Freeview
  • Fuel and power inc. in rent
  • Bed linen and towels inc. in rent
  • Off-road parking available
  • Enclosed rear terrace with furniture, enclosed surrounding garden with lawn, decking, furniture and barbecue
  • Pet-friendly
  • Sorry, no smoking
  • Shop 4.6 miles, pub 3.2 miles
  • Note: Due to the property being based on a working farm, dogs must be kept on a lead

About the location

PELYNT

Polperro 3.6 miles; Looe 3.9 miles; Fowey 8.6 miles; Liskeard 8.8 miles.

Deriving its name from the Cornish word 'pluw' meaning parish, Pelynt is a charming village resting in the beautiful county of Cornwall. Less than four miles from the large fishing port town of Looe and the delightful shores of the Polperro Heritage Coast, Pelynt makes an excellent inland base for your next visit to Cornwall, surrounded by glorious countryside and within reach of the vast Bodmin Moor. The village is home to a local convenience shop as well as a SPAR, along with a pub, Jubilee Inn, providing all you need for your self-catered stay. Explore the exciting town of Looe, home to the beautiful East Looe Beach, popular for swimming, you can wander along the pier, take a stroll along the riverfront, and sample the tasty delicacies in the many restaurants and cafés scattered around, with some local history to be discovered at Old Guildhall Museum and Gaol. The idyllic village of Polperro offers a scenic day out, with the pretty Polperro Harbour and Polperro Harbour Heritage Museum showcasing the rich maritime heritage here, with the village also home to the quaint Polperro Model Village. Venture along the South West Coast Path, now recognised as the Charles III Coastal Path, for stunning coastal walks, visit the famous Eden Project, and ramble over the wonderful Bodmin Moor.
